The soundtracks, primarily composed by Hans Zimmer and Klaus Badelt , are highly regarded for their "epic" orchestral and synthetic blend. Audiophiles seeking FLAC (Free Lossless Audio Codec) versions often prioritize the series' later installments, like At World's End , which transitioned to more lush, full-blown orchestrations compared to the heavily synthesized early scores. The musical journey of the Pirates of the Caribbean film franchise is as epic and layered as the adventures of Captain Jack Sparrow himself. Spanning five films released between 2003 and 2017, the scores have become some of the most recognizable and beloved in modern cinema. The music masterfully blends heroic themes with the swashbuckling spirit of the high seas, creating an unforgettable auditory experience.
